So this is your first time going to COMMON and your thinking to yourself it’s going to be scary, or maybe you just don’t know where to go or when to arrive.

Sunday - You need to make sure you are in Nashville early on Sunday. All the fun starts Sunday afternoon. If you are going to do a session on Sunday then you need to be there on Saturday, but at the least be at the hotel Sunday @ 12 PM. That way you can walk around and get to know the joint. The Expo floor opens @ 1 PM and you really want to spend as much time in there getting all the free crap they bring, and learning about their products. I will explain the Expo later too.

Make sure you have your week layed out as to what you want to do and what you want to attend and kind of make mental notes as to where those rooms are. It will help you later during the week. You will of course be able to find a map and I will explain what to do with that later.
